Aime Forest
Aimé Forest is a Philosophe French (1898 - 1983).
Professor at the university of Montpellier. The work of Forest counts not only works but especially a number impressing of articles. Its philosophy, of influence thomist, opens out in philosophy of the spirit. Forest will be in particular very attentive with French spiritualistic philosophy (Lavelle, the Seine, Madinier, Marcel…). Aimé Forest is the author of an essential article to include/understand what was reflexive philosophy: " Role and nature of the réflexion" in Assent and creation (cf bibl.)
